Who we’re looking for? 1–2 years’ experience in real estate sales or leasing (commercial ideal, strong residential also suitable) in a fast‑paced environment. Able to manage a high‑volume pipeline across multiple campaigns, from pitch and marketing through to enquiries and closing. Strong communicator who can confidently work with owners, buyers and tenants while building rapport quickly and representing Knight Frank professionally. Highly organised and detail‑focused, able to juggle inspections, follow‑ups, timelines, documentation and internal coordination. Comfortable handling sales admin tasks such as gathering property details, preparing proposals/IMs and supporting research. Holds a current NSW Certificate of Registration (or equivalent) and ready to hit the ground running. The role Work for Knight Frank’s fast‑paced Parramatta commercial sales team, teaming up with the lead agent to ignite campaigns—listing, marketing, selling and keeping a high‑energy pipeline. This role gives you exposure across a dynamic mix of commercial assets and is perfect for an ambitious agent who thrives on variety, big‑ticket enquiries, fast turnarounds and the chance to level up your commercial career in a team that backs your growth. Key Responsibilities Drive day‑to‑day commercial sales activity, supporting a high‑volume Parramatta pipeline from enquiry to settlement (plus some leasing). Be a key point of contact for owners, buyers and prospects—managing enquiries, inspections and follow‑ups to keep campaigns moving. Prepare proposals, pitches and property information, using market evidence to support pricing and campaign recommendations. Coordinate marketing campaigns end‑to‑end, including IMs, collateral and accurate, on‑time advertising and digital content. Support transactions through offers, negotiations, documentation, due diligence and maintaining clean deal records. Help grow the business by identifying new opportunities, keeping CRM data updated and contributing to team‑wide canvassing.
